Remote control: Smart fob or mechanical key

Depending on the car model depending on the car model, you may have a smart key fob or one that is mechanical. Most keys have transponder chips or transmitters that sends a signal to the door when it is opened. The key can also be used to open doors and to start the engine.

Most keyless entry vehicles are equipped with a "start" button. The feature that allows you to start by pressing it is known as the E-Z Passive System. The start button isn't always marked, but it should be. The function is identified by a circular arrow on most keys.

Make sure you review the instruction manual. Certain models require you to use a flat-head screwdriver to open the slot. Other models may require jeweler's screwsdrivers.

Honda key fobs offer an array of useful features. For instance, they are able to lock and unlock doors, activate memory seat settings, as well as start the engine remotely. They also provide 24-hour roadside service. If you require assistance you can use the HondaLink app to get in touch with the technician.

Some key fobs include an emergency key blade, which can be used to begin the vehicle if the battery is dead. Some models have an inductive coupling feature, which allows the key to be charged if the battery is not working.

Installing a new battery on an original key from Honda

If you've lost your key or want to replace a dead battery, changing the battery on your honda replacement key cost uk key is a simple and simple process. This will save you time and money. This guide will guide you through the process.

Then, you need to open the fob. To get the key out you'll need an screwdriver with a flat head. If you're not sure of how to open the fob, refer to the manual for the Honda model.

Once you've got the key in, you'll want to test the buttons. Although the key fob is programmed to unlock and close the doors, it is important to verify that they work properly. You can also unlock the doors to start the engine.

Next, you'll need to remove the key metal from the fob. This may be done using a jeweler's screwdriver. It's a good idea to keep a spare key on hand if you're replacing the battery.

The next step is to put in the new battery. Most Honda models use a flat, circular 3-volt battery. These batteries can be found at your local hardware store or online at AutoZone.

It is vital to ensure that the battery has been installed correctly. Make sure that the positive and negative indicators are facing upwards. Also, you'll want to make sure that the rubber film is not against the buttons.
